Vulnerability, Embolism, and Repair Air embolisms (cavitation) interrupt water columns, often triggered by drought, freeze–thaw cycles, or mechanical damage. Embolism spreads via air-seeding through pit membranes when pressure differentials exceed threshold. Plants employ strategies for mitigation and repair: embolism-resistant anatomy, hydraulic segmentation, synthesis of new xylem, and active refilling mechanisms (root pressure, phloem-derived solutes creating localized positive pressures, or metabolic activity of adjacent parenchyma). The efficacy of refilling under tension is debated and likely species- and context-dependent.
